Ticket #4182: the Broomcloset stale-branch cleanup bot deleted two branches that had open merge requests against the release line. Root cause appears to be the bot checking branch age but not open-MR status after last week's API migration. Branches have been restored from reflog; no commits lost. Requesting this be flagged in the release notes and the bot pinned to the prior build. The affected bot build is identified below.

trace token, fafog-kageg: htk4_98e6

CI note for new contractors on the Hartwell profile-store resharding: the migration job in pipeline `shard-rollout` fails intermittently because shard 7's seed fixture exceeds the test container's memory cap. Workaround: set the fixture scale flag to half in your local runner config before re-triggering. Do not retry more than twice; the orchestrator marks the shard dirty after that and a teardown is needed. The build identifier you should quote when escalating is listed below.

session token of bawep-yadup = htk21_528abd376e3c5a4ec24a1

## Authentication

The Shelfwright importer pulls MARC records from the Lanternfield catalogue service. Auth is a single static key passed in the X-Shelfwright-Key header; no OAuth, no refresh flow. The key is scoped read-only to the catalogue namespace, so don't expect write calls to succeed. Rotate via the Lanternfield admin panel quarterly. For local runs against staging, use the key below.

service key, yadug-bajog: zpat3_pou

☐ Verify the slimmed Corvat build image before the key ceremony begins. The support team must confirm the distroless base passed the Lintfjord scan and that debug shells were stripped. Once the image digest is witnessed and logged, unseal the ceremony vault using the recovery passphrase below.

vault phrase of hahop-hawef = ralael-ralath-aldok

- [ ] Step 7: Archive cold storage buckets (Glacierline tier). Confirm both ceremony witnesses are present, verify bucket manifests match the Oxbow ledger, then seal the archive key shares. Plugin authors may observe but not handle shares. Once sealed, the archive index itself is encrypted and can only be reopened with the passphrase below.

vault phrase of badup-hahig = tamael-aldael-kelmir-istael-fenok-istwyn-tamius-jorath-oliion